Kayo 2021 Off-Road Model Lineup – ATVs and Dirt Bikes

For 2021, Kayo is proud to announce some great new models and updates to their line of affordable and dependable ATVs and dirt bikes.

The top selling 125cc sport ATV, the Predator, gets an aggressive look with new plastic body work for 2021. LED running lights, disc brakes and an automatic transmission with reverse make this unit very popular with the younger sport ATV riders.

On the utility side, the Bull 125 also gets new body work and LED headlights and LED running lights. Front and rear racks, disc brakes and a reliable engine round out the Bull 125. The Predator and the Bull are covered by a 6-month limited warranty.

On the dirt bike side, Kayo introduced the K-series of dirt bikes. Both the K2 and the K4 come with simple yet reliable, air-cooled 4-stroke engines and electric starters. A front number plate/headlight, disc brakes and a three-month limited warranty round out the features on these bikes.

The company is really excited about the K6 EFI and the KT 250 2-stroke. The K6 EFI is a fuel injected 250 cc 4-stroke that is ready to tackle off-road adventures. Electric start, front and rear lights and disc brakes round out the model. The KT250 is a light and nimble off-road bike for those who prefer 2-stroke power delivery. The KT also comes with an electric start, front and rear lights and disc brakes. Both the K6 EFI and the KT are covered by a three-month limited warranty.
